Atmospheric Release Advisory Capability (ARAC) response to the Three Mile Island accident
Description
A discussion is presented of the three general classes of support provided by the Atmospheric Release Advisory Capability (ARAC) and describes the role played by ARAC in support of DOE during the Three Mile Island accident in March and April of 1979. 6 refs
